The 1894 Swarthmore Quakers football team was an American football team that represented Swarthmore College as an independent during the 1894 college football season. The team compiled a 5โ€“5 record and outscored opponents by a total of 230 to 202. Jacob K. Shell was the head coach,[1]and Hodge served as the captain.[2]

The rivalry game against Haverford is considered to have the first "action shot" photograph during a football game.[3]
